在探讨“属性”这一概念时,我们首先需要明确它所涵盖的广泛含义。属性,作为一个哲学、逻辑学以及计算机科学等领域中常用的术语,其内涵丰富,用途广泛。本文将从不同角度出发,对“属性”这一概念进行解读。

一、哲学角度
在哲学领域,属性是指事物所具有的内在特征或性质。这些特征或性质是事物存在的基础,也是事物区别于其他事物的关键。例如,红色是苹果的一个属性,它使得苹果在视觉上与其他颜***分开来。在哲学中,属性通常分为两类:本质属性和非本质属性。本质属性是事物固有的、不可分割的属性,如苹果的“可食用性”;而非本质属性则是事物可以改变的属性,如苹果的“大小”。
二、逻辑学角度
在逻辑学中,属性是指对事物进行分类和描述的基本要素。属性可以用来区分不同的事物,也可以作为判断事物之间关系的依据。例如,在描述人的属性时,我们可以从性别、年龄、职业等方面进行分类。在逻辑学中,属性通常分为两类:个体属性和类属性。个体属性是指某个具体事物所具有的属性,如“张三是男性”;类属性是指某一类事物共有的属性,如“所有人类都有呼吸”。
三、计算机科学角度
在计算机科学中,属性是指数据对象所具有的特征。在面向对象编程中,属性是对象的一个组成部分,用来描述对象的状态。例如,一个学生对象可以具有姓名、年龄、性别等属性。在计算机科学中,属性通常具有以下特点:
1. 唯一性:每个属性在对象中只能有一个值。
2. 可变性:属性的值可以在程序运行过程中改变。
3. 类型:属性具有特定的数据类型,如整数、字符串等。
4. 访问权限:属性可以被设置为私有、公共或保护,以控制对属性的访问。
四、总结
综上所述,属性是一个多维度、多领域的概念。在哲学、逻辑学以及计算机科学等领域中,属性都扮演着重要的角色。从不同角度理解属性,有助于我们更好地认识世界、描述事物以及构建计算机程序。在今后的学习和工作中,我们应关注属性这一概念,不断拓展自己的知识视野。
「点击下面查看原网页 领取您的八字精批报告☟☟☟☟☟☟」